When Was the Battle of Haldighati Fought?

The Battle of Haldighati was fought on 18 June 1576. It happened in a place called Haldighati, which is near the Aravalli hills in Rajasthan. This place got its name from the yellow color of the soil which looks like haldi (turmeric). This battle was a big moment in the history of Mewar and the Rajputana region.

Battle of Haldighati Was Fought Between Whom?

Many students and people search battle of haldighati was fought between who – so here is the clear answer. This battle was between Maharana Pratap, the brave king of Mewar, and the Mughal emperor Akbar’s army, which was led by Raja Man Singh of Amber.

On one side was Rajput pride and freedom. On the other side was the Mughal empire who wanted to control Mewar. But Maharana Pratap didn’t accept to become a servant under the Mughal rule. That’s why this war was not just a battle, it was a fight for freedom.

Who Won the Battle of Haldighati?

The battle didn’t have a clear winner. The Mughal army had more soldiers and better weapons. But they couldn’t catch or defeat Maharana Pratap. In fact, Maharana Pratap escaped safely and later he even got back many areas of his kingdom. So even if it looked like the Mughals had upper hand, Maharana Pratap is seen as the true hero and winner by the people of India.

Chetak – The Brave Horse of Maharana Pratap

One part of this war that touches everyone’s heart is the story of Chetak, Maharana Pratap’s horse. Chetak was not a normal horse. He was brave and loyal. Even after getting injured in the battle, Chetak took Maharana Pratap away from the battlefield safely.
